In a real cross-pollination of series TV and film, Mandate Pictures has acquired an untitled comedy pitch from Aziz Ansari and 30 Rock writer Matt Hubbard, that Harris Wittels will write as a star vehicle for Ansari and Danny McBride. Wittels is a writer on the NBC sitcom Parks and Recreation, which stars Ansari, and McBride jumps between features and East Bound and Down, the HBO sitcom that he created with Jody Hill. 
Rough House, the production shingle that McBride runs with Hill, David Gordon Green and Matt Reilly, will produce. Logline’s under wraps, and it’s the second teaming of Ansari and McBride, who’ll also star in 30 Minutes Or Less, the pizza deliveryman comedy directed by Zombieland‘s Ruben Fleisher. Ansari, who’ll next be seen in Get Him to the Greek, was just set to host the MTV Movie Awards on June 6. McBride stars with James Franco and Natalie Portman in the Universal comedy, Your Highness.
Ansari will be exec producer with Mandate president Nathan Kahane.
